ToothMaker: Realistic Panoramic Dental Radiograph Generation via Disentangled Control.

Weihao Yu, Xiaoqing Guo, Wuyang Li

    IEEE Transactions on Medical Imaging
    |July 28, 2025
    PubMed
    Summary
    This summary is machine-generated.

    ToothMaker generates high-fidelity dental X-ray images using diffusion models. This novel framework improves diagnostic model training by accurately synthesizing tooth structures and dental concepts, reducing the need for manual data annotation.

    Area of Science:

    • Medical Imaging
    • Artificial Intelligence
    • Computer Vision

    Background:

    • High-fidelity dental radiographs are crucial for training diagnostic AI models.
    • Existing generative methods struggle with dental radiology's complexity, leading to inaccurate structures and concepts.
    • Generative approaches for dental radiology remain largely unexplored.

    Purpose of the Study:

    • To investigate diffusion-based teeth X-ray image generation for the dental domain.
    • To introduce ToothMaker, a novel framework for high-fidelity dental image synthesis.
    • To improve the accuracy and realism of generated dental radiographs.

    Main Methods:

    • Developed ToothMaker, a framework employing diffusion-based generation.
    • Introduced control-disentangled fine-tuning (CDFT) for style and layout control.
    • Proposed prior-disentangled guidance module (PDGM) using LLMs and hypergraph networks for dental concept synthesis.

    Main Results:

    • ToothMaker successfully synthesizes high-fidelity and diverse dental X-ray images.
    • The generated data significantly improved performance in downstream segmentation and visual question answering tasks.
    • The approach demonstrated a reduced reliance on manually annotated data.

    Conclusions:

    • ToothMaker is the first diffusion-based framework specifically designed for dental X-ray image generation.
    • The proposed CDFT and PDGM strategies effectively address challenges in dental image synthesis.
    • Generated data from ToothMaker can enhance diagnostic model training and reduce annotation efforts.
